In order to formulate a customized approach to best benefit the individual, therapists first inquire about their patient's lifestyle and health goals. As such, someone who deals with a great deal of stress and tension may require a full body technique, while an athlete might only need attention on a specific area.

Depending on the severity of the condition in question, therapy should generally take about fifteen to twenty minutes. At the Ellenville NY chiropractic facility, massage therapy can be administered after each session of chiropractic adjustments. Massage should be painless, so patients who experience discomfort are encouraged to let the therapist know so that the amount of pressure being placed on muscles and tissues can be adjusted.
